Faith in the Face of Disaster: UU Response to Hurricane Katrina
Statement from the General Assembly of Unitarian and Free Christian Churches, United Kingdom
September 29, 2005
Dear William,
British Unitarians have viewed the events surrounding the hurricanes Katrina and Rita with great concern. Television coverage by the BBC has brought the full picture of human misery to our attention. Your message of 6th September has been widely circulated and is a major feature of our denominational newspaper "The Inquirer" of 24th September. This provides us with a pathway for active response.
The British General Assembly has allocated $1,000 to the Gulf Coast Relief Fund and the London and Provincial District is joining us with a further $500. Additionally, we are urging our members to donate online directly to the Gulf Coast Relief Fund. I am sure that many will do so.
We are inspired by the spontaneous activities being undertaken by UUA congregations within and adjacent to the stricken areas. This is the true meaning of community. We send them our love and our admiration, as well as our financial contribution.
